Title 45, Chapter 13, Section 2
( 45-13-2)
Before entering on the duties of his office, the Secretary of State
shall execute a bond with sufficient securities, to be approved by
the Governor, in the sum of $10,000.00, conditioned for the faithful
performance of all the duties of his office and all such duties as
shall be required of him by the General Assembly or the laws of this
state and for a faithful accounting of all the public money or
effects that may come into his hands during his continuance in
office. It shall be filed in the office of the Governor; and a copy
thereof, certified by one of the Governor's secretaries under the
seal of the office of the Governor, shall be received in evidence in
lieu of the original in any of the courts of this state. |
